Today is our last look back through the history pages of ICE, charting the growth of the Society and endocrinology internationally. Today, we examine from 1996 until the present day.

ICE 1996, San Francisco, USA: The 10th anniversary of this prestigious global gathering was held in collaboration with The Endocrine Society in June in San Francisco, USA.

ICE 2000, Sydney, Australia: Following the Olympic Games, this Congress was hosted at the Sydney Convention & Exhibition Centre in the Millennium year and attracted 3300 registrants from 75 countries.

ICE 2004, Lisbon, Portugal: The football fans in Lisbon for the Euro 2004 tournament had departed and were replaced with over 3200 endocrinologists attending this meeting at the Lisbon Congress Centre. A comprehensive programme of plenary lectures, symposia, oral communications, ‘meet the professor’ workshops and poster sessions made for a most fruitful congress.

ICE 2008, Brazil: This well attended and lively meeting presented cutting edge clinical and basic science of current interest to all those involved in endocrine care and discovery in the bright and exciting milieu of a Rio Springtime.

ICE 2010, Japan: This was the first new style ICE meeting under the revised statutes of the ISE. The Japan Endocrine Society organised an outstanding Congress that brought together over 5,000 leading endocrinologists from around the world. The Congress was honoured to welcome the Emperor and Empress of Japan to the Opening Ceremony!

ICE/ECE 2012, Florence, Italy: This prestigious joint meeting with our regional partners, the European Society of Endocrinology, is taking place in the unique setting of the Fortezza da Basso, a masterpiece of the military Renaissance in the centre of Florence, Italy.
